Output 3fb80d39ea02df499c374f8dfd215f2fa16400bbc0a5d53a444d39bc078a102c:0

value
897506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c031ae257c52a307f43dff31ecc18196f74ea55f OP_EQUAL
address
3KDFBDioHezBKDSWBDMD4VTb9B6UbNpTes
transaction
3fb80d39ea02df499c374f8dfd215f2fa16400bbc0a5d53a444d39bc078a102c
confirmations
132050
spent
true